Key Differences
In short — Core i7-10700K outperforms the cheaper Core i5-10400 on the selected game parameters. However, the worse performing Core i5-10400 is a better bang for your buck. The better performing Core i7-10700K and the cheaper Core i5-10400 have been released at the same time.
Advantages of Intel Core i5-10400
- Up to 45% cheaper than Core i7-10700K - $130.0 vs $235.99
- Up to 44% better value when playing Assassin's Creed Valhalla than Core i7-10700K - $0.74 vs $1.31 per FPS
- Consumes up to 48% less energy than Intel Core i7-10700K - 65 vs 125 Watts
Advantages of Intel Core i7-10700K
- Performs up to 2% better in Assassin's Creed Valhalla than Core i5-10400 - 180 vs 176 FPS
- Can execute more multi-threaded tasks simultaneously than Intel Core i5-10400 - 16 vs 12 threads

Geekbench 5 Benchmarks
Intel Core i5-10400 | vs | Intel Core i7-10700K |
---|---|---|
Apr 30th, 2020 | Release Date | Apr 30th, 2020 |
Core i5 | Collection | Core i7 |
Comet Lake | Codename | Comet Lake |
Intel Socket 1200 | Socket | Intel Socket 1200 |
Desktop | Segment | Desktop |
6 | Cores | 8 |
12 | Threads | 16 |
2.9 GHz | Base Clock Speed | 3.8 GHz |
4.3 GHz | Turbo Clock Speed | 5.1 GHz |
65 W | TDP | 125 W |
14 nm | Process Size | 14 nm |
29.0x | Multiplier | 38.0x |
UHD Graphics 630 | Integrated Graphics | UHD Graphics 630 |
No | Overclockable | Yes |
